Normal USTR Operations Continue Amid Shutdown, ‘Using Existing Funds’

Despite partial government shutdown, the Office of the U.S. Trade Representative continues “to conduct all operations,” including trade negotiations and enforcement activities, “using existing funds,” the agency said on Dec. 28.
